Ingredients

1 1/3 cups blanched almonds
1 cup butter or margarine
1/2 cup s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la
2 cups sifted flour
1/2 cup confectioners' sugar
2 teaspoons nutmeg

How to make Nutmeg Butterballs

Put almonds through coarse blade of food chopper.
Cream together but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
Blend in almonds and vanilla.
Add flour and mix well.
Chill dough thoroughly.
Shape dough into balls about the size of walnuts.
"Place on greased baking sheets.
Bake in a slow oven (300° F) 15 to 20 minutes, or until lightly browned.
Combine confectioners' sugar and nutmag.
Roll cookies in this mixture while hot.
When cool, roll in sugar-nutmeg mixture again.
